## Quartzline Environments

The legacy ORM layer in Quartzline was refactored to the new mapper in sprint 41. Staging and prod now run the refactored code; the sandbox tier still uses the old adapter until Q3. Support should route query-timeout tickets to the Datapath squad. Each environment reads its own settings at boot. The current staging values are listed below.

settings of tagef-bawif:
DRUIX_HOST=druix.zemvarlabs.internal
DRUIX_PORT=8000

- [ ] **Step 7: Breaker override escrow.** After sealing the signing keys for the Tallgrove upstream API circuit breaker, confirm the support team can force the breaker open during a full outage. The override bundle lives in the sealed escrow drawer and is useless without its unlock phrase. Two ceremony witnesses must initial this step before proceeding. The escrow bundle is decrypted with the recovery passphrase that follows.

vault phrase of kahip-kahop = holath-quenmir

Ticket VRAM-882: The nightly build of MemScope, our GPU memory profiling toolkit, fails its artifact signature check on the Halcyon CI runners. The profiler binary itself builds cleanly; the failure occurs only when verifying the packaged kernel-sampler module. I traced it to the packaging step re-signing with a stale certificate after the October rotation. The fix updates the pipeline to pull the current key at build time. For verification during review, the correct signing key is included below.

rollout seal: bky9_PeXH1fTLY

Visitors and contractors at Pellam Yard: if the fire alarm goes off, don't just follow the crowd and hope for the best — head to the assembly point on the gravel forecourt by the flagpoles. Your host is responsible for you, but the warden runs a roll call from the visitor log, so make sure you signed in properly at reception. Once the all-clear is given, re-entry is through the side door only, not the main lobby, and you'll need the re-entry code below.

door code, yagap-bahof: bdg-O-05